Deputy Headteacher
Bradford, BD2 3JD

  • Full time, permanent
  • Pay Scale: L7 – L11 (£57,831 - £63,815)
  • September 2025 start date

Please Note: Applicants must be authorised to work in the UK

This school is part of a Catholic Academy Trust, a family of 17 primary and 2 secondary schools dedicated to providing outstanding Catholic education. Located in Fagley, this school welcomes children from all faiths and backgrounds, championing a diverse and inclusive school culture. With high aspirations for every pupil, they celebrate achievements and regularly engage in meaningful community and charity work.

The Role

They are looking for a committed leader who will work closely with the Headteacher to deliver their mission. This is a class-based role with weekly dedicated management time.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Support and articulate a clear vision for Catholic education
  • Play a central role in school leadership, development, and faith life
  • Lead the spiritual development of pupils and staff
  • Use data to drive whole-school improvement
  • Inspire excellence in teaching, learning, and behaviour
  • Promote effective partnerships with parents, the Trust, and wider community
  • Ensure high standards of safeguarding and child protection
  • Contribute to strategic planning, governance, and staff performance management
